HumanaChoice H7617-007 (PPO) (H7617-007) is a $47-premium Medicare Advantage PPO from Humana Inc. available in Buffalo County, Wisconsin in 2026, with a 4.5-star overall rating, a $9,250 in-network out-of-pocket maximum, and a $615 annual Part D drug deductible.

How it compares in Buffalo County

The CMS CY2026 Landscape file lists 35 Medicare Advantage plans in Buffalo County, Wisconsin, of which 0 carry a 5.0-star overall rating and 19 have a $0 consolidated monthly premium. Consolidated premiums range from $0.00 to $269.00 per month, and in-network out-of-pocket maximums range from $1500.00 to $9250.00.

How to verify your doctors take this plan

Network participation changes throughout the year; we hold no provider-network data, so verify directly with these three sources before you decide:

  1. Open the plan's official Medicare.gov page and use its provider-directory link: Medicare.gov Plan Finder — H7617-007.
  2. Call the plan (Humana Inc.) using the member-services number listed on that plan page and ask whether each doctor, hospital, and pharmacy is in-network for 2026.
  3. Get free, unbiased help from your State Health Insurance Assistance Program (SHIP) — see free unbiased Medicare help from SHIP.

What H7617-007 means

CMS assigns every Medicare Advantage and Part D offering a plan identifier made of three parts. In H7617-007, the leading H marks the contract type (H = Medicare Advantage / Part C contract), the four digits 7617 are the contract number issued to the organization, and the three-digit 007 is the plan benefit package under that contract. The segment ID 0 identifies the service-area segment within the plan (0 = the default single segment).
